ОсновноеRadiotalkПользовательское
MPCHAT - CMS хостинг чатов для профессионалов
90   •   Посмотреть все темы

Фильтрация смайлов

 

1163
Денис @Анатолич
Можно ли отключить показ смайлов? готовое решение Render написал тут https://vmeste.eu/forum?pid=313687#p313687
/* Функция отключения смайлов */
if(smileon) {text=text.replace(/<.*\S+ title="(\s.*\s)" \S+.*>/gim,"<a href=#>$1</a>"); /*console.log(text);*/}

задача усложняется тем, что нужно скрыть не все смайлы а только определенные.
После звездочки у всех восклицательный знак. *!название *!название2.
Как скрыть картинки именно для этих смайлов?

7094
Dim @Render
Будет заменять только эти
*!название *!название2.

if(smileon) {text=text.replace(/<.*\S+ title="(\s\*!.*\s)" \S+.*>gim,"<a href=#>$1</a>");}